Types Of E-bikes
There are several types of e-bikes, each designed for different purposes. Understanding these types will help you pick the one that best fits your needs:
- City E-Bikes: Ideal for urban commuting and short rides. These bikes have a comfortable upright position and are perfect for casual rides.
- Mountain E-Bikes: Built for off-road adventures. They are rugged, with sturdy frames and powerful motors to handle tough terrains.
- Hybrid E-Bikes: A mix between city and mountain e-bikes. These are versatile and can handle both city streets and light trails.
- Folding E-Bikes: Perfect for those with limited storage space or who need to combine biking with public transport. They are compact and easy to carry.
Key Features To Consider
When choosing an e-bike, consider the following key features to ensure it meets your fitness and lifestyle needs:
Feature | Description |
---|---|
Battery Life | Look for a bike with a long-lasting battery, especially if you plan to use it for longer rides or multiple fitness activities in a day. |
Motor Power | The motor’s power will determine how much assistance you get while riding. Choose a motor that suits the terrain you’ll be riding on. |
Frame and Build | The frame should be sturdy but not too heavy. A lightweight frame makes it easier to handle and combine with other fitness activities. |
Comfort | Ensure the bike has a comfortable seat and adjustable handlebars. Comfort is key, especially for longer rides. |
Accessories | Consider additional features like lights, racks, or fenders that can enhance your riding experience and make the bike more versatile. |

Interval Training
Interval training involves alternating between high and low-intensity activities. You can e-bike at a fast pace for a few minutes. Then switch to running at a slower pace. This type of training boosts cardiovascular health. It also burns more calories. Start with short intervals. Gradually increase the duration as your fitness improves. Interval training keeps your workouts dynamic and challenging.
Recovery Rides
Recovery rides are low-intensity rides that help your body recover. They are perfect after a strenuous run. E-biking allows you to stay active without overexertion. It aids in muscle recovery and reduces soreness. Keep a steady, comfortable pace. Focus on smooth, easy pedaling. This helps in flushing out toxins from your muscles. Recovery rides ensure you stay on track with your fitness goals.

Core Strength Exercises
A strong core is essential for maintaining stability and balance, both on and off the bike. Here are some simple yet effective core exercises to include in your routine:
- Planks: Planks are a highly effective way to engage your entire core. Try holding a plank position for 30 seconds to start, then gradually increase the duration as you get stronger.
- Bicycle Crunches: This exercise mimics the pedaling motion of biking and targets the obliques. Lie on your back, lift your legs, and alternate bringing your elbow to the opposite knee.
- Russian Twists: Sit on the floor with your knees bent and feet lifted slightly off the ground. Hold a weight or a ball, and twist your torso from side to side. This movement works your obliques and improves rotational strength.
By adding these core exercises into your fitness plan, you’ll enhance your overall biking performance and protect yourself from injuries.

Flexibility Routines
After an exhilarating e-bike ride, your muscles may feel tight, especially if you’ve been climbing hills or pushing your speed. This is where yoga steps in to save the day. By incorporating flexibility routines, you can effectively stretch those muscles and prevent soreness.
- Forward Bend: Stand with your feet hip-width apart and slowly bend forward, reaching for your toes. This stretch targets your hamstrings and lower back.
- Cat-Cow Pose: Get on all fours and alternate between arching your back (cat) and dipping it down (cow). This pose helps in stretching the spine and relieving tension.
- Downward Dog: From all fours, lift your hips towards the ceiling, forming an inverted V shape. This pose stretches your calves, hamstrings, and shoulders.
These routines are simple yet effective. They ensure that your muscles remain flexible and ready for your next e-bike adventure.
Balance Exercises
Balance is crucial, not just for yoga but for biking too. When you’re on an e-bike, good balance can make your ride smoother and safer. Yoga helps improve your balance through various poses and exercises.
- Tree Pose: Stand on one leg, with the other foot resting on your inner thigh. Focus on a fixed point to maintain balance. This pose strengthens your legs and core.
- Warrior III: Stand on one leg while extending the other leg and your torso parallel to the ground. It’s like flying! This pose engages your core and improves stability.
- Eagle Pose: Wrap one leg around the other and do the same with your arms. This pose tests your balance and enhances your focus.
Practicing these balance exercises can make a significant difference in your e-biking. They help you stay steady on uneven terrains and navigate sharp turns with ease.

Nutrition For E-bikers
Nutrition plays a crucial role in the performance of e-bikers. A balanced diet fuels your body, enhances endurance, and speeds up recovery. Combining e-biking with other fitness activities requires a well-thought-out nutritional plan. This ensures you have the energy and nutrients needed for optimal performance. Here are some tips on nutrition for e-bikers.
Pre-ride Meals
Eating the right foods before an e-bike ride can make a big difference. A good pre-ride meal should be rich in carbohydrates. This provides the energy needed for the ride. Include some protein to help sustain energy levels. Avoid foods high in fat and fiber. They can cause stomach discomfort during the ride.
Examples of pre-ride meals include oatmeal with fruits, a banana with peanut butter, or a smoothie with yogurt and berries. Eating 2-3 hours before the ride allows time for digestion. If you need a quick snack, a piece of fruit or an energy bar 30 minutes before the ride works well.
Post-ride Recovery
After an e-bike ride, your body needs nutrients to recover. A post-ride meal should contain protein and carbohydrates. Protein helps repair muscles. Carbohydrates replenish glycogen stores. Aim to eat within 30 minutes to an hour after your ride.
Good post-ride meals include a chicken wrap, a protein shake with fruit, or a bowl of quinoa with vegetables. Hydration is also important. Drink plenty of water to replace fluids lost during the ride. Adding a pinch of salt or an electrolyte tablet to your water can help replenish lost electrolytes.

Setting Achievable Goals
Setting goals is like having a roadmap for your fitness journey. Without them, it’s easy to feel lost or overwhelmed. Here’s how you can set achievable goals:
- Be Specific: Instead of saying, “I want to get fit,” say, “I want to ride my e-bike for 30 minutes, three times a week.”
- Make Them Measurable: Use numbers to quantify your goals. This makes it easier to track your progress.
- Be Realistic: Set goals that are challenging yet attainable. This ensures you stay motivated without feeling discouraged.
- Set a Timeline: Give yourself a deadline. For example, “I want to achieve this goal in three months.”
Remember, the key is to start small and gradually increase the difficulty of your goals. It’s all about steady progress. Celebrate your achievements, no matter how small, and adjust your goals as needed.
